Fortnite Festival Season 13 event dates and schedule
Fortnite Festival Season 13 runs from early February to mid-April 2026, with all Chappell Roan / Pink Pony Club content and the Heartcore Music Pass available during this window.
Core dates
-
Season 13 start date: February 5, 2026, launching alongside update v39.40 after scheduled downtime.
-
Season 13 end date: April 16, 2026, when the Festival season and its Music Pass are scheduled to expire.
-
Total duration: About 70 days of Festival Season 13 content.
Launch timing and downtime
-
Update downtime begins around 4:00 AM ET (09:00 UTC) on February 5, 2026, with matchmaking disabled roughly 30 minutes beforehand.
-
Servers typically come back online 1-2 hours after downtime starts, at which point Festival Season 13 and its playlists become playable.
-
In Europe (including the Netherlands), this means the season effectively opens late morning to midday on February 5, 2026, depending on exact server uptime.
